The fashion world is buzzing, and Gracie Abrams is at the center of it all! Last week, she graced the streets of London with her unique blend of vintage and sporty style as she stopped by BBC Radio One. The rising star, known for her hits and her fashion-forward choices, didn't disappoint as she promoted her upcoming album, *Daughter From Hell*, in the Live Lounge.
Sporty styles are taking over, from Aubrey Plaza's maternity chic to Hailey Bieber's post-pilates outings. The world is in the grip of major sports events like the NBA finals and FIFA World Cup, and Gracie Abrams has added her flair to the mix. On June 18, she was spotted in cream track pants highlighted with maroon stripes, perfectly paired with a vintage fencing top from Balenciaga's Spring/Summer 2003 collection.
“I love mixing eras and styles, and this look just felt right for London,” Abrams shared with a smile.
This eye-catching top featured vibrant red, green, and gold stripes, and a distinctive placket with oversized buttons. Her chic ensemble was completed with Chanel shoes and a statement black flap bag, along with Coco Crush jewelry, showcasing her role as a brand ambassador. Her style was complemented by her grown-out bixie cut, a fresh look since her last public appearance at the Met Gala in May.
